how to shift the android layout when admob is available?
i'm using this layout xml to show both my activity and the admob: first i thought it will shift the upper layout when the admob is available, but it is not... do you guys have any idea?
<LinearLayout xmlns:android="http://schemas.android.com/apk/res/android"
android:orientation="vertical"
android:layout_width="fill_parent"
android:layout_height="fill_parent"
android:background="@drawable/wonder"
>
<TextView
android:layout_width="fill_parent"
android:layout_height="wrap_content"
android:text="@string/hello"
android:textColor="#000"
/>
<ListView
android:id="@+id/auto"
android:layout_width="fill_parent"
android:layout_height="wrap_content"
android:headerDividersEnabled="false"
android:footerDividersEnabled="false"/>
<LinearLayout
xmlns:myapp="http://schemas.android.com/apk/res/com.anim.list"
android:layout_width="fill_parent"
android:layout_height="wrap_content">
<com.admob.android.ads.AdView android:id="@+id/ad"
android:layout_width="fill_parent"
android:layout_height="wrap_content"
myapp:backgroundColor="#000000"
myapp:primaryTextColor="#FFFFFF"
myapp:secondaryTextColor="#CCCCCC" />
</LinearLayout>
</LinearLayout>

SOLVED
Sorry buddies, I use this layout to solve my problem
<RelativeLayout xmlns:android="http://schemas.android.com/apk/res/android"
android:layout_width="fill_parent"
android:layout_height="fill_parent"
android:orientation="vertical"
android:background="@drawable/wonder">
<LinearLayout android:layout_width="fill_parent"
android:id="@+id/home_layout"
android:orientation="vertical"
android:layout_above="@+id/ad_layout"
android:layout_height="wrap_content">
<!-- Put all your application views here, such as buttons, textviews, edittexts and so on -->
<TextView
android:id="@+id/inf"
android:layout_width="fill_parent"
android:layout_height="wrap_content"
android:text="@string/hello"
android:textColor="#000"
/>
<ListView
android:id="@+id/auto"
android:layout_width="fill_parent"
android:layout_height="wrap_content"
android:headerDividersEnabled="false"
android:footerDividersEnabled="false"
/>
</LinearLayout>
<LinearLayout android:layout_width="fill_parent"
android:id="@+id/ad_layout"
android:layout_height="wrap_content"
android:gravity="bottom"
android:layout_alignParentBottom="true">
<com.google.ads.AdView
xmlns:ads="http://schemas.android.com/apk/res/com.anim.list"
android:id="@+id/adView"
android:layout_width="fill_parent"
android:layout_height="wrap_content"
ads:adSize="BANNER"
ads:adUnitId="a14db7f475a6f8d"
/>
</LinearLayout>
</RelativeLayout>
Now, I got it works! thanks!
Remove your adview from xml instead change it to linearlayout
<LinearLayout
android:layout_below="@+id/TextView01"
android:orientation="vertical"
android:layout_width="fill_parent"
android:id="@+id/layout_ad" android:layout_height="wrap_content"/>
and in your code
LinearLayout layout = (LinearLayout) findViewById(R.id.layout_ad);
AdWhirlLayout adWhirlLayout = new AdWhirlLayout(this, "your key");
Display d = this.getWindowManager().getDefaultDisplay();
RelativeLayout.LayoutParams adWhirlLayoutParams = new RelativeLayout.LayoutParams(d.getWidth(), 52);
layout.addView(adWhirlLayout, adWhirlLayoutParams);
This is how I implemented in my app
Use RelativeLayout and flag the upper view with layout:above="@+id/your_ad"
